Breaking-News >> WorldNews China Embassy in Nepal reminds China citizens and institutions in Nepal to pay attention to preventing heavy rainfall
According to announcements from the Ministry of Hydrology and Meteorology of Nepal and the National Disaster Reduction and Emergency Management Agency, from October 3 to 6, heavy monsoon rainfall is expected in many places across the country in Bagmati Province, Kosi Province, and Lumbini Province in Nepal. Especially in the Kathmandu Valley in Bagmati Province, Sindu Barchok, Resova and Chitwan, which may cause floods in small rivers and rising water levels in main rivers. Local disaster management committees will Control the traffic of vehicles based on road and weather conditions. The Embassy in Nepal reminds China citizens and institutions in Nepal: First, pay close attention to the weather conditions, check the weather forecast issued by the local competent authorities in time, and strictly abide by the early warning tips of the local government departments. Try not to travel before October 6th, especially avoid traveling at night. Pay attention to traffic safety, check the road traffic situation before departure, choose safe and reliable transportation means and routes, pay attention to preventing strong winds, storms, floods, slopes, mud streams, thunderstorms and other natural disasters, especially as much as possible to avoid mountainous areas and high-risk areas. 3. Improve awareness of risk prevention and make preparations for emergency disaster prevention. Especially in Chinese-funded enterprises prone to landslides and settlements along rivers, they must maintain a high degree of vigilance, comprehensively investigate potential risks, consolidate safety protection measures for construction operations, and strengthen personnel management and protection requirements, and prepare disaster prevention and daily necessities in advance. Focus on strengthening night inspections and making preparations for timely evacuation. If conditions permit, temporarily transfer to safe open areas or highlands. Effectively improve emergency disaster response capabilities and comprehensively ensure the safety of personnel and property. 4.
